Client Q & A

Question: I’m concerned that if I start writing articles or blogging on my topic before my product is ready to launch, someone could steal my information and copy me before I have everything copyrighted. How can I build a list without getting ripped off.

Joel

Answer: I’ve actually had this come up in conversation twice this week besides your question. And both times it surprised me because I haven’t heard anyone talk about being ripped off for several years.

I think the main reason most people don’t have this fear anymore is speed to market. Meaning that by the time you start putting pieces out there, you’re far enough ahead that nobody is going to get it out before you.

You have to accept the fact that at the same time you’re creating your product, there could be 12 other people who saw the same space in the market and felt they could fill it.

There is an old saying, “Money loves speed.” It’s true. The person who gets the product to market the fastest stands the best shot, but they aren’t always the winner.

Someone who isn’t you is never going to be as successful telling your story as you are. Unless you give them a long lead time.

So if you are half done with your project and you start sharing little pieces as blog posts or articles, you have little to worry about. How is someone going to steal your process or system or theories if you’re only doing a 200 word post or a 5 minute video or a 750 word article?

Fear of loss is not an abundant way of being in your business or your life. People can always try to steal your ideas, even if they are copyrighted it can be changed just enough to be legal. So don’t approach it from that space. Share openly knowing that what you have is uniquely you and you can’t be stolen or duplicated.

Other people can do products on the same topic, but they will all be different from yours. Don’t let this fear rule your business and prevent you from building a list that will build your financial future.
